WebApr 26, 2016 · Now there is only a single Mexican gray wolf population that lives in the mountains of central Arizona and New Mexico. As of the most recent count in February 2024, the sole wild Mexican gray wolf population had only 113 wolves, making it one of the most endangered mammals in North America.
